Analysis

Djibouti recorded 68.2% for completion rate, lower secondary education, both sexes (modelled data) in 2025. That is the highest value across all 45 years on record.

The figure is up 2.0% on the previous year and up 22.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, completion rate, lower secondary education, both sexes (modelled data) in Djibouti peaked at 68.2% in 2025 and was at its lowest, 15.2%, in 1981.

That places Djibouti 106th out of 164 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 45 years of available data.
